PlayStation 2 save files come in different formats depending on how they were extracted from the original console or virtual memory cards. Format Extension Description Compatibility Full virtual memory card image. Overwrites your entire existing AetherSX2 memory card slot. .max / .cbs Action Replay or CodeBreaker formats. Requires conversion or direct import via the app menu. .psu Single-game save format. The cleanest option; injects only God of War data. Step-by-Step Installation Guide
